I sail on a river of chimeras
Where a moon kiss embraces
My lacerated shadow.
Imbued with rage,
Drowned in sadness,
I attempted to tear the night apart
To steal a star
That could keep me company.
Yet, this tyrant existence held me captive
In the solitude of a fog
Tinted indigo and orchid.
